Dr. Mikael Palner is an associate professor in the Department of Clinical Research at the University of Southern Denmark, studying the biological correlates of maladaptive neuropsychiatric diseases—such as anxiety, obsessive-compulsive disorder, post-traumatic stress syndrome.

He joins us to discuss his research on the positive effects of psilocybin microdosing on stress resiliency, compulsions, and neuroplasticity; as well as what microdosing IS NOT good for, and some important cautions to consider with respect to potential harms of microdosing.

We also discuss why studies in rats show clear biological effects of microdosing on behaviour, but human studies seem to suggest placebo; a neural level definition of psychedelic microdosing; why microdosing research is being polluted by a lack of specificity; the value of the “psychedelic” effect of psychedelics in their use as a medicine; and why what rats need higher doses of psychedelics than human by weight.
